Entry Requirements

You must possess one of the following:

  • Foundation Diploma
  • National Diploma
  • Advanced GNVQ/AVCE
  • UCAS 120 points (2 A Levels grade E and above)
  • ESOL requirements IELTS score of 6
  • GCSE English grade C or above
  • A level qualifications alone will be considered with an appropriate portfolio of work or experience in the fashion industry

Curriculum

Year 1

  • Introduction to historical and theoretical studies
  • Knitted textiles
  • Printed textiles
  • Woven textiles
  • Specialist studies 1
  • Introduction to fashion studies
  • Introduction to business and professional practice
  • Visual research and introduction to CAD

Year 2

  • Historical and theoretical studies 2
  • Business and professional practice 2
  • Specialist studies 2
  • Fashion studies 2
  • CAD/Illustration
  • Work placement: Simulated

Year 3

  • Historical and theoretical studies: Theoretical 3 or
  • Historical and theoretical studies: Practical 3
  • Business and professional practice 3
  • Industrial project
  • Final major project: Design development
  • Final major project: Resolution
  • Final degree: Viva (oral exam)
